The Data Science MSc at the University of Northumbria Newcastle is designed for ambitious graduates seeking to master the analysis, synthesis, and management of complex data. In today's data-driven world, organisations rely heavily on extracting actionable insights from diverse datasets, and this programme equips you with the essential skills to meet that demand. You will explore advanced techniques in Big Data and Cloud Computing, statistical programming, and machine learning, preparing you for a dynamic career where you can drive informed decision-making. This postgraduate degree is ideal for those with a background in computing, information sciences, or mathematical disciplines.
This full-time, on-campus Masters degree is studied over two years, providing a comprehensive and practical learning experience. You will engage with core modules covering Principles of Data Science, Advanced Databases, and Statistical Programming, alongside crucial areas like Machine Learning and Big Data. The curriculum is structured to build your expertise progressively, culminating in a significant MSc Computer Science & Digital Technologies Project in your final year. You will graduate with a robust portfolio of skills in data analysis, programming (Python and R), and data visualisation, ready for roles as data scientists in industry and beyond.
